English grammar infinitives. Write the words in brackets in the correct forms either to infinitives or gerund in English.
As soon as she started (speak) I realized that she was not Scottish.
Did you manage (finish) the rapport on time?
He agreed (help) her in the kitchen.
He crashed his car into a lamp post to avoid (hit) a dog.
He suggested (dine) dining at the restaurant, but we couldn’t afford (eat) there.
I gave up (ski) after one day because I kept (fall) over.
I really don’t feel like (go) to work today.
Tom does not appear (care) about whether she passes or fails.
What do you intend (do) when you graduate from university?
Why did you refuse (lend) his car?
